The Impact of Heat on Your Vehicle

The intense Louisiana sun does more than just make you reach for your sunglasses. It can have a profound effect on your vehicle’s performance. Heat can exacerbate existing issues and create new ones, making it crucial to pay attention to your car’s warning signals.

Common Heat-Related Car Issues

  • Overheating: High temperatures can cause your engine to overheat, particularly if your cooling system isn’t functioning optimally. This is a common summer issue that can trigger your check engine light.
  • Battery Trouble: Heat can accelerate battery fluid evaporation, potentially leading to a weakened battery or a complete failure, which might cause a warning light to illuminate.
  • Fuel System Issues: The heat can cause fuel to evaporate quicker, which might affect the pressure in your fuel system and cause your check engine light to come on.
  • Tire Pressure Fluctuations: While not directly related to the check engine light, fluctuating tire pressure due to heat can affect overall vehicle performance.

What Your Check Engine Light Might Be Telling You

The check engine light is part of your vehicle’s onboard diagnostics system. It’s designed to alert you to potential problems, ranging from minor issues to significant mechanical failures that require immediate attention.

Possible Causes for the Check Engine Light

1. Loose or Damaged Gas Cap: A common and easily fixable issue, a loose gas cap can cause your check engine light to turn on. It’s crucial for maintaining the proper pressure in the fuel system.

2. Faulty Oxygen Sensor: This sensor monitors the unburned oxygen in your car’s exhaust system. A malfunctioning sensor can lead to decreased fuel efficiency and increased emissions.

3. Catalytic Converter Problems: If your catalytic converter is failing, your vehicle’s emissions will increase, and its performance will suffer. This is a critical issue that requires immediate attention.

4. Mass Airflow Sensor Malfunction: This sensor helps your car’s computer determine the correct mixture of air and fuel for the engine. A faulty sensor can lead to poor performance and reduced gas mileage.

5. Spark Plug or Ignition Coil Issues: These components are essential for your engine’s operation. Problems here can lead to misfires, increased emissions, and poor fuel economy.

The Importance of Addressing the Check Engine Light Promptly

Ignoring the check engine light is never a wise decision. While it might be tempting to dismiss it as a minor issue, doing so can lead to more significant problems down the road. The heat of summer in Slidell, LA, can exacerbate issues, causing them to develop into costly repairs if not addressed timely.

Benefits of Timely Diagnostics and Repairs

  • Prevent Major Repairs: By addressing issues early, you can avoid more extensive and expensive repairs.
  • Improve Fuel Efficiency: Fixing problems like faulty sensors can enhance your vehicle’s fuel economy, saving you money at the pump.
  • Ensure Safety: A well-maintained vehicle is safer to drive, giving you peace of mind on the road.
  • Maintain Vehicle Value: Regular maintenance and prompt repairs help preserve your car’s value over time.
